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Green Road to Rochdale start from as little as £10.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Green Road to Rochdale are available for £58.30 one way, or £79.00 return

Facilities and Accessibility at Green Road Station

Green Road Station may be compact, yet it’s equipped with practical facilities. While the station lacks a staffed ticket office, fear not, as you can still collect your tickets from convenient ticket machines on-site. Be sure to take advantage of the accessible ticket machines that accommodate all types of passengers, providing an ease of purchase at the touch of a button.

Traveling with mobility needs? Green Road does provide partial step-free access and level entry from the car park or level crossing via a ramp, making it a Category B station. However, facilities such as accessible toilets, staff help, and dedicated accessible parking spaces are not available. Passengers can request additional assistance directly from train conductors on arrival.

If you're planning an extended waiting time at the station, please note the absence of waiting rooms and lounges, though you will find available seating areas. Keep an eye on the time as Green Road does not offer refreshment facilities, ATMs, or shops; plan accordingly for your adventurous travels.

Transport Links at Green Road

Although Green Road offers a tranquil retreat, it's well-connected to the surrounding areas through various transport links. Should rail replacement be necessary, services pick up or drop off passengers just a mile away at the bus stop on The Green. For those preferring private travel, taxis are accessible through Northern Railway’s cab company, providing a seamless continuation of your journey (Northern Railway - Cab For You).

Local bus services also serve the station, providing another means to explore the locality, with details available through Busline on 0870 608 2608. While bicycle hire isn't offered directly at the station, exploring other nearby stations such as Barrow-In-Furness or Millom for alternative hire options could prove beneficial.

Station Facilities and Amenities

Rochdale train station is well-equipped to cater to your needs. With a ticket office open from early morning till late night, purchasing or collecting your pre-booked tickets is hassle-free. Ticket machines are available and accessible, accepting both cash and cards. For those who prefer using smartcards, the station supports issuing and validating them.

Step-free access is provided across the station, making it scooter and wheelchair friendly. While accessible toilets are not available, regular toilet facilities ensure basic needs are met. Though there aren't dedicated waiting rooms, the station offers ample seating for those waiting for their train's arrival.

Onward Travel Options

Convenient transport links make Rochdale station a hub of connectivity. If your journey includes rail replacement services, be assured of a smooth transition with pick-up and drop-off at the Network Rail Parking Bay right outside the station. For taxi services, Northern Railway’s Cab4You service is at your disposal.

Buses to Bury and Bolton are readily accessible on Maclure Road, with the busline service reachable at 0871 200 2233. Although there's no bike hire directly at the station, an extensive public transport system ensures that Rochdale is well connected via GMPTE with queries at 0161 228 7811.
